Greece Schengen Visa from Vietnam — Trends
The Greece Schengen visa refusal rate for applicants from Vietnam was 5.6% in 2024, down from 35.3% in 2013.
Verified from European Commission · 2010–2024 historical data

Year-over-Year Statistics
| Year | Applications | Issued | Refused | Refusal R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2013 | 990 | 640 | 349 | 35.3% |
| 2014 | 453 | 434 | 19 | 4.2% |
| 2015 | 572 | 537 | 35 | 6.1% |
| 2016 | 907 | 725 | 173 | 19.3% |
| 2017 | 898 | 784 | 114 | 12.7% |
| 2018 | 2,049 | 1,927 | 122 | 6.0% |
| 2019 | 1,503 | 1,390 | 103 | 6.9% |
| 2020 | 103 | 65 | 3 | 4.4% |
| 2021 | 72 | 68 | 0 | 0.0% |
| 2022 | 806 | 741 | 28 | 3.6% |
| 2023 | 1,335 | 1,235 | 80 | 6.1% |
| 2024 | 1,423 | 1,321 | 79 | 5.6% |
